24-Hour Sports Club and Bar


Mayweather and Pacquiao event

I was lucky to have been invited last Sunday, May 3, at Sparks Club Sports bar, located at the 2nd floor of Guilly’s Island restaurant in Tomas Morato, Quezon City to watch the live Pay Per View of Mayweather and Pacquiao Battle for Greatness fight, and not only that, it comes with a free buffet breakfast. Who wouldn’t refuse such an offer? It’s a rare opportunity so I grabbed the chance immediately when they sent me an invite. Although I had to wake up early last Sunday to make it to the call time, an extra effort for me is a gesture to reciprocate their generosity.


It was my first time to visit the place, but I did not have a hard time locating their establishment near the intersection of Tomas Morato and Eugenio Lopez Drive. I was greeted by Ms. Mikaela at the entrance door and led me to the second floor with some other invitees who were already seated at the high bar chairs reserved exclusively for invited guests.


Dining
The room was dimly lighted and cool which makes cozy ambiance, a perfect atmosphere while sipping the cup of coffee offered to me by their crew. The room is equipped with 5 large televisions mounted on the wall strategically located so that a guest can have a view of the show on TV. The sound system is good also. Aside from high bar chairs they also have high back dining sofa, so if you wanted your conversation to be a little bit private you can opt to be seated there. I tried sitting on both and I prefer the high back sofa because I can slouch or lean to relax my back on the padded backrest.

heavy breakfast 

The breakfast buffet was offered when almost all the seats are occupied by invitees and guests. We lined up at the bar area where the sumptuous Filipino breakfast menu was being served. First on the array of food is an option of plain or fried rice, seconded by different egg menu – omelet and sunny side up egg, thirdly meat menu – Tocino, Longaniza, Beef Tapa, and Arozcaldo with hard boiled egg. Also included is the Pandesal.

Baliuag Bulacan procession on Holy Week

Betrayal of Jesus
Betrayal of Jesus 

     Every Holy week, in the observance of Catholic religious activities in the Philippines, some churches are holding a Lenten procession which starts at 7:00 in the evening of Good Friday from the Church and ends at the Church.   The procession has carriages with statues of Jesus Christ and other biblical icons which depicts the story of Jesus’ crucifixion.  The number of carriages varies in every Church because it depends on its community on how many families or organization has their own and who has enlisted to join the procession.
